Step1: Recall ionic - compound properties
Ionic compounds are formed by the transfer of electrons between a metal and a non - metal. Beryllium (Be) is a metal and fluorine (F) is a non - metal.
Step2: Analyze question 5
Most ionic compounds are solid at room temperature due to the strong electrostatic forces between ions.
Step3: Analyze question 6
Ionic compounds generally have high melting points because of the strong ionic bonds holding the ions together. So the statement "Ionic compounds generally have low melting points" is false.
Step4: Analyze question 7
- a. When dissolved in water, ionic compounds dissociate into ions which can conduct electricity. This is true.
- b. When melted, ionic compounds also dissociate into ions and can conduct electricity. So the statement "When melted, ionic compounds do not conduct electricity" is false.
- c. Ionic compounds have very stable structures due to the strong electrostatic forces between oppositely charged ions. So the statement "Ionic compounds have very unstable structures" is false.
- d. Ionic compounds are electrically neutral because the total positive charge of the cations equals the total negative charge of the anions. This is true.
